Job Description






Job Description




  • As an experienced Electrical Engineer with 4 years of hands-on expertise, you will be responsible for ensuring the efficient operation, maintenance, and improvement of electrical systems at the plant and client stations.

  • You will work independently and with teams, leveraging your advanced troubleshooting skills, project coordination, and technical knowledge to support plant and client operations.



Responsibilities




  • Analyze and maintain plant electrical data to identify areas for improvement in equipment performance, driving the optimization of electrical systems.

  • Ensure the uninterrupted and reliable power supply to plant operations, overseeing electrical load management and fault analysis.

  • Troubleshoot, repair, and maintain electrical equipment and panels both independently and within a team, ensuring minimal downtime.

  • Lead initiatives to ensure the efficient, safe, and reliable operation of critical electrical systems, including Black State Diesel Generators, electric motors, motor control panels, and breakers.

  • Oversee and troubleshoot plant instrumentation and control systems, particularly for the compression and decanting processes of Compressed Natural Gas (CNG).

  • Independently or with a team, coordinate and execute electrical installation projects for both plant and client stations, ensuring all electrical work meets industry standards.

  • Perform commissioning and decommissioning of Pressure Reduction and Metering Stations (PRMS) at client stations, ensuring proper setup and functionality.

  • Collaborate with third parties, contractors, and internal teams to service electrical equipment and install PRMS systems, ensuring all electrical projects are completed on time and to specification.

  • Take the lead in troubleshooting, maintaining, and installing instrumentation and control devices used for measuring and controlling pressure, flow, temperature, and level on compressors and PRMS.

  • Provide technical assistance to third-party teams for the integration of instrumentation and controls into larger systems, especially during calibration and installation.

  • Contribute to the design, development, and implementation of advanced instrumentation and control systems for more efficient plant operations.

  • Work closely with maintenance teams to plan and execute preventive and corrective maintenance tasks for electrical and instrumentation systems, ensuring continuous plant operation.

  • Mentor and provide support to operators and maintenance staff, offering guidance on the effective use and troubleshooting of electrical and instrumentation systems.

  • Perform routine maintenance of PLCs (Programmable Logic Controllers) and HMIs (Human-Machine Interface) systems to ensure seamless integration and efficient user interaction with automated systems.

  • Lead the design, installation, and maintenance of control panels for new electrical equipment and devices, ensuring all systems meet safety standards and functional requirements.

  • Apply industry best practices to ensure safety in the design and operation of electrical panels and associated devices, ensuring compliance with safety regulations.



Qualifications




  • Bsc, Hnd in Electrical engineering

  • 4+ years of experience in electrical engineering, with strong knowledge of electrical equipment, instrumentation, and control systems.

  • Proven expertise in troubleshooting, repair, and maintenance of electrical systems, instrumentation, and control devices.

  • Experience with commissioning and decommissioning of PRMS and related electrical infrastructure.

  • Advanced understanding of PLCs, HMIs, and control panel designs.

  • Strong project management skills, with experience in coordinating and overseeing electrical installation projects.

  • Familiarity with safety standards and regulatory compliance for electrical systems and panels.

  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team, providing technical expertise and leadership on electrical and instrumentation projects.
